powered by simpleCommunicator - 2.0.18     © 2024 Programmizd 02
Map
Форумы / Microsoft SQL Server [закрыт для гостей] / Как повернуть таблицу на 90°?, Поиск: Сообщение содержит картинки  
1 сообщений из 1, страница 1 из 1
Microsoft SQL Server / Как повернуть таблицу на 90°?
    #110796
Дед-Папыхтет
Скрыть профиль Поместить в игнор-лист
Участник
Просто Трёп  09.08.2022, 13:27
[игнорируется]
Дед-Папыхтет  09.08.2022, 11:53
[игнорируется]
Просто Трёп  09.08.2022, 11:07
[игнорируется]
Если имею на входе датасет id1, id2, id3, id4, а на выходе хочу получить одну строку value1, value2, value3, value4?

Ну или другими словами, на входе я имею два запроса, один отдает 3 строки, второй 4 строки. А мне надо получить одну таблицу 3 на 4. Размерность заранее неизвестна, но не бесконечна.

Наверняка это все уже решено, но я не знаю, по каким словам гуглить.
Давай более конкретно - пример таблиц и данных и что за СУБД? MSSQL? MySQL?
MS SQL.
С таблицами сложно. Есть два результата запросов, они промежуточные и нигде не хранятся. Получаются каждый раз, когда юзверь чего-то хочет.
1 l_val4 3 l_val1 4 l_val1 1 str1 1 str2 3 str3 4 str4
Надо получить табличку 3 на 4
l_val4 + str1 l_val4 + str2 l_val4 + str3 l_val4 + str4 l_val1 + str1 l_val1 + str2 l_val1 + str3 l_val1 + str4 l_val1 + str1 l_val1 + str2 l_val1 + str3 l_val1 + str4
только без динамического sql обязательно нужно знать все значения колонок... в твоем случае 4 колонки...
ptpivot.JPG
...
Рейтинг: 2 / 0
1 сообщений из 1, страница 1 из 1
Форумы / Microsoft SQL Server [закрыт для гостей] / Как повернуть таблицу на 90°?, Поиск: Сообщение содержит картинки  
Читали тему (1): Анонимы (1)
Игнорируют тему (1): erbol 
Читали форум (1): Анонимы (1)
Пользователи онлайн (103): Анонимы (98), Tosh, Google Bot, жЫвоглот 5 мин., Bing Bot 6 мин., erbol 7 мин.
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]